Scala Seq和Set

無名 发表于: 2016-06-22   最后更新时间: 2016-06-22  
  •   0 订阅,1355 游览

Scala Seq和Set

SeqSet是针对现实使用场景的不同数据结构抽象。

简单来说
Seq列表,适合存有序重复数据,进行快速插入/删除元素等场景
Set集合,适合存无序非重复数据,进行快速查找海量元素的等场景

总之,最大的区别不在语言实现上,而是数据结构的使用上,

var seq = Seq[String]()
seq = seq :+ "hello"

var set = Set[String]()
set += "hello"






发表于: 1年前   最后更新时间: 1年前   游览量:1355
上一条: Scala的futue和promise
下一条: Scala flatMap和map

评论…


  • 评论…
    • in this conversation
      提问